LYSON W229E
6. Before starting the extractor:
•
Make certain the 1-
1/4” honey drain valve is
open, so honey can drain to a container below the
open valve.
Pooling honey in the bottom of the extractor can impede the rotation and
damage the extractor!
•
Only load one size of frame in each extracting load. Processing mixed frame sizes leads to
poor balance and extraction.
•
Make sure that frames are correctly arranged and well balanced.
•
Insert the power plug into the socket
and press the power toggle switch (from “0” to “1”
).
•
The controller will at this time perform a self-
diagnosis signaled by the “0” digit flickering. If any
faults are detected, the controller will not respond until the fault is removed. (See CDD-2
controller manual for help).
7. Start the extractor by pressing the + button. Press the + or
–
buttons as needed to adjust the motor
speed to your required level. Extract at low speed initially, and then gradually increase the speed as
the frames empty of honey. If the extractor begins to vibrate, decrease the speed until the vibration
stops. Extract until the frames are mostly empty of honey. Please note that the time required to extract
your honey will depend on the type of honey, the size (depth) of the frame, and the temperature of the
honey. Accelerating too quickly can result in poor extraction, comb damage and excess wear of the
extractor.
8. Once extraction is complete, press the
–
button until the display reads “0”
and press the power
switch off (from “1” to “0”).
Warning!!! Frames can only be rearranged when the basket has fully stopped!
SECTION 3: Assembly Instructions
W229E Motorized Model
Tools Required:
Metric wrenches and/or sockets (various sizes, 6 to 17mm)
6mm Allen wrench (other sizes needed are included with extractor)
Scissors or knife
1.
Unpack all components carefully and ensure all components are present as shown below. Do not
set extractor directly on floor; place a few pieces of packing material underneath each side to prevent
the center shaft from resting on the floor. Now is a good time to remove the white plastic film from the
extractor.
